The global energy transition is placing new and unprecedented demands on Distribution System Operators (DSOs). Alongside upgrades to grid capacity, processes such as digitization, capacity optimization, and congestion management are becoming vital for delivering reliable services.
Power Grid Model is an open source project from Linux Foundation Energy and provides a calculation engine that is increasingly essential for DSOs. It offers a standards-based foundation enabling real-time power systems analysis, simulations of electrical power grids, and sophisticated what-if analysis. In addition, it enables in-depth studies and analysis of the electrical power grid’s behavior and performance. This comprehensive model incorporates essential factors such as power generation capacity, electrical losses, voltage levels, power flows, and system stability.
Power Grid Model is currently being applied in a wide variety of use cases, including grid planning, expansion, reliability, and congestion studies. It can also help in analyzing the impact of renewable energy integration, assessing the effects of disturbances or faults, and developing strategies for grid control and optimization.

In order to explore how we use language today it was important to look at how our language has evolved over time. The English language is essentially a flea market of words, handed down, borrowed or created over more than 2000 years. And it is still expanding, changing and trading.
Our language is not purely English at all - it is (to quote the British Library!) a ragbag of diverse words that have come to our island from all around the world. Words enter the language in all sorts of ways: with invaders, migrants, tradesmen; in stories, artworks, technologies and scientific concepts; with those who hold power, and those who try to overthrow the powerful. And of course once upon a time, the richness of language was kept from the ‘common people’ who couldn’t read and had no access to books. This underlines the old adage that knowledge = power. The underclass weren’t allowed to further their knowledge so they stayed in their place.
And of course the print press changed all that. And now several centuries later, here we are with a language that is the product of of world wars, technological transformation, and globalisation. Our language continues to grow, expanding to incorporate new jargons, slangs, technologies, toys, foods and gadgets.
So as we can’t escape the growing use of technical terms and jargon in our everyday lingo, how best to go about harnessing language for what we do in learning?
Well the aim of the game – whether it’s within the learning itself or as part of your online community or just general communications such as emails – is to ENGAGE people. As you can see here, to engage someone is a verb, it’s a doing word. So you need to be active in putting some effort in when you try to engage with others.
First thing to consider is who are you talking to? You need to have at least some understanding of who your target audience is before you start engaging with them. Is it a particular department or team? Is it the company directors? Think about their role and their behaviours and try and incorporate this understanding into your communications e.g. Directors will always be short of time – can you grab them with a message that says ‘Please spare me 20 seconds to read this!’
And what’s the objective you’re trying to achieve? Is it an email communication to inform people a new piece of e-learning is coming? It might be one of the dreaded emails that tells everyone they have to complete a certain piece of learning by a certain date because it’s mandatory. Whatever it is you’re bound to want to get them to take the bait so always consider how the language you use can help achieve this.
For example, do you just want them to be aware that something is coming? If so, ensure your language is impactful and concise so readers don’t get bored. Or is there a call to action - something you specifically want people to do after reading your communication or taking your e-learning? Let’s face it, most of the time there is, so consider how language can help to engage people to do this.
The use of active verbs is a great way to write more efficient and more powerful sentencesthan using passive verbs. Some examples here show how language can encourage people to do something positive like ‘achieve’ or ‘update’ or to go on a voyage of discovery by ‘trying’ or ‘discovering’. When a passive voice is used, the people you are trying to engage often end up having something done to them rather than being the do-er themselves.
